DISTINGUISHING FEATURES OF THE CLASS: This is a management-level position responsible for managing and monitoring the overall performance, operation, maintenance, and repair of energy management systems and networks operating in various buildings. Work involves capital improvement projects and other administrative duties associated with the HVAC group. This position is distinguished from Principal HVAC Service Engineer by its responsibility for administrative functions such as developing standards and procedures, efficiency management, and capital improvement plans. The employee reports directly to and works under the general supervision of an Associate Engineer or other administrative-level employee. General supervision is exercised over supervisory and/or other HVAC staff; does related work as required.

FULL PERFORMANCE K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, ABILITIES AND PERSONAL CHARACTERISTICS: Thorough knowledge of management principles and practices as related to HVAC systems; thorough knowledge of the operation and management of HVAC systems and networks; thorough knowledge of the operation and repair of refrigeration equipment, electrical equipment, boilers, and heat pumps; thorough knowledge of preventive maintenance and servicing needs of systems; thorough knowledge of possible dangers to heat and safety relating to asbestos, insulation wastes, chemicals, etc.; thorough knowledge of energy management troubleshooting techniques; thorough knowledge of agency safety, regulations and devices; thorough knowledge of energy conservation measures; good knowledge of agency capital improvement parameters and plans as related to HVAC systems; supervisory ability; administrative ability; analytical ability; ability to identify, develop and implement energy management standards and troubleshooting procedures; ability to read and write specifications, read blueprints wiring, piping schematics, and technical books; good judgment; physical condition commensurate with the demands of the position.

Pay Transparency Disclaimer: The posted salary range represents the full salary scale for this position, which includes all pay steps within the range. The starting salary for all new hires is typically at the entry-level figure, as determined by the step placement of the Collective Bargaining Agreement. Progression through the range occurs over time based on established criteria such as length of service and performance. This range is provided to give applicants an understanding of the potential earnings over the course of a career in this role.
